How Alcohol Is Quietly Destroying Filipino Men's Health

Dr. Quincy Raya in Daily Health

Most Filipino men think alcohol only damages the liver, but this belief misses a much bigger problem. Alcohol caused more than 24,500 deaths in the Philippines in 2021, with men experiencing 21.1 deaths per 100,000 from liver cirrhosis alone and a staggering 136 deaths per 100,000 from cancer. The  Department of Health has stated there is no safe level of alcohol consumption , yet many Filipino men continue drinking without understanding the full range of  health risks  they face.

Sunflower Oil vs Coconut Oil for Hair: Which Is Better for You?

Hair Health Team in Daily Health

Choosing between oils for hair care can feel overwhelming, but understanding the differences makes the decision easier. Coconut oil is better than sunflower oil for  preventing hair damage  and protein loss, making it the stronger choice for most hair types. Research shows that  coconut oil reduces protein loss in both damaged and undamaged hair , while sunflower oil does not provide this benefit.
